What is the significance of unrealized gains in the cryptocurrency industry?

Can you explain the importance of unrealized gains in the cryptocurrency industry and how it affects investors?

- At BYDFi, we understand the significance of unrealized gains in the cryptocurrency industry. Unrealized gains are a key metric that investors consider when evaluating their investment performance. They provide insights into the potential profitability of their holdings and can help investors make informed decisions. Unrealized gains also contribute to the overall market sentiment and can influence the demand and supply dynamics of cryptocurrencies. As a result, they play a crucial role in shaping the market trends and investor behavior. It's important for investors to monitor their unrealized gains regularly and adjust their investment strategies accordingly to maximize their returns.
